Moving Nature is an animation series by loooop studio’s Stephane Leopold (DFT) that beautifully captures the essence of animal motion using a single continuous line. From the sprint of a cheetah to the effortless glide of a manta ray, each looped sequence distills movement into its purest form, revealing the rhythm and structure of wildlife in motion.
Set against a black background, the animations use a simple white line to depict these iconic animal movements. This minimalist approach isn’t just artistic—it’s also energy-efficient, as it reduces screen power consumption by turning off over 95% of pixels on mobile devices. By integrating sustainability into digital art, Leopold’s work aligns with more eco-conscious design practices.
Beyond aesthetics, Moving Nature highlights the structural and kinetic beauty of animal movement. The seamless loops reflect the cyclical nature of life, emphasizing how even the most complex motions can be expressed through simplicity.
